Circus performers entertain King's Lynn crowd




A crowd gathered today in Lynn as they were entertained by a circus act duo in the town centre.

Pirate Taxi displayed their talents to onlookers who paused with their shopping to take a look.

Alix Young, assistant manager, Vancouver Quarter said: "Circus performers took to the streets this week thanks to the Vancouver Quarter and Discover King’s Lynn.

"Pirates of the Carabina brought their Pirate Taxi show to New Conduit Street which saw daring gymnastic and acrobatic feats performed in, around and above a London black cab. "The pair have recently performed at Glastonbury festival.

"Mat-E-Tricks, who’s been performing at the Fringe in Edinburgh, showcased his fire eating and hoop skills in pop-up performances on Broad Street."

More free street entertainment will be on offer next Wednesday, August 31, between 11am and 3pm in the Vancouver Quarter.
